(5:41)</p><p>•   I like how you said you showed the video because that's something that we talked about in that webinar, where some of the teachers that were present in the webinar, they had said, what if you're just not funny, that's just not something that your gift at then how do you put humor in the classroom... What he said was ingenious, and he said that literally, you use someone else's...  Show a YouTube video, or you find something that's funny and then just share it with the kids, you're still incorporating humor, it doesn't have necessarily be your humor, you don't have to be this hilarious person, if you can incorporate it, then that makes it all the better.
